Résumé : |
Data fusion is an emerging technology to fuse data from multiple data or information of the environment through measurement and detection to make a more accurate and reliable estimation or decision. In this Article, energy consumption data are collected from ethylene plants with the high temperature steam cracking process technology. An integrated framework of the energy efficiency estimation is proposed on the basis of data fusion strategy. A Hierarchical Variable Variance Fusion (HWF) algorithm and a Fuzzy Analytic Hierarchy Process (FAHP) method are proposed to estimate energy efficiencies of ethylene equipments. For different equipment scales with the same process technology, the HVVF algorithm is used to estimate energy efficiency ranks among different equipments. For different technologies based on HVVF results, the FAHP method based on the approximate fuzzy eigenvector is used to get energy efficiency indices (EEI) of total ethylene industries. The comparisons are used to assess energy utilization states of different equipments and technologies. It is helpful to decision-makers to identify quantitative energy consumptions and major influence factors to improve energy-saving chances. Furthermore, the proposed strategy can be used to evaluate energy efficiencies in other process units too. |
